[
Login
] [
Register
]
|
Contact us
|
中文
Home
Search Parts
Vehicle
Product
Member
Suppliers
Hot Searches
1133932
1664105
2D0513029M
41060-89E92
4416915
4433061
5030474
5030476
5206N8
5206P2
or
Post Buying Request
Suppliers
MABYPARTS
OTK030002
Find The OE Number:
1302453Y10
NPS
N115N02
Find The OE Number:
1302453Y10